Remote work is becoming more and more popular as technology advances and companies embrace the idea of flexible work. But even with the flexibility, it can be hard to maintain team morale and keep activities engaging. That’s why it’s important to come up with creative ways to keep remote teams connected and motivated. Here are five simple steps to help make remote team fun activities more enjoyable.


1. Utilize Technology

Technology is your friend when it comes to remote team fun activities. There are plenty of tools and apps available to help facilitate team-building activities and games. From virtual reality games to video conferencing apps, there’s no shortage of ways to keep your team connected and engaged.

2. Create a Game Night

Game nights are a great way to build team morale and get everyone involved in the fun. Set aside some time each week or month for everyone to come together and play games. You can keep it simple with classic board games or get creative with online quizzes and trivia.

3. Encourage Socialization

Socialization is an important part of team-building. Encourage your team to get to know each other and build relationships. Set up virtual happy hours or coffee breaks to give everyone a chance to catch up and chat. You can also host virtual team lunches for a more in-depth conversation.

4. Host Online Events

Online events are a great way to keep your team engaged. From virtual movie nights to mini-golf tournaments, the possibilities are endless. The key is to make sure the events are fun and relevant to the team.

5. Give Rewards and Recognition

Rewards and recognition are essential to keeping team morale high and motivating employees. Show your team members appreciation and gratitude by offering rewards for good work and recognizing team milestones. This is a great way to keep everyone connected and engaged.

Creating an enjoyable remote team environment doesn’t have to be complicated. By utilizing technology, creating game nights, encouraging socialization, hosting online events, and giving rewards and recognition, you can create a fun and engaging atmosphere for your remote team.
